When assessing your server demands, you'll often face a decision between rack servers and blade servers. Both offer powerful computing check here capabilities, but their designs differ noticeably. Rack servers are conventional tower systems that house individual components in a isolated chassis. Blade servers, on the other hand, are dense devices integrated into a centralized chassis, with multiple blades accessing common resources like supply and cooling.

, In conclusion, the optimal solution depends on your specific needs and expectations.

Scaling Economics of Scalability: Analyzing Rack Server Costs

Understanding the financial implications of scaling your infrastructure is crucial. When evaluating rack server costs, several factors must be examined. These encompass hardware prices, power consumption, cooling needs, and maintenance expenses.

By meticulously analyzing these costs, you can identify the most efficient solution for your individual needs. Keep in mind that a cheaper upfront investment doesn't always translate to long-term savings.

Additionally, factors like future development and the sophistication of your workloads should be factored into your choice.

Construct Your Dream Data Center: Choosing the Perfect Rack Server for You

When building your dream data center, selecting the perfect rack server is a critical step. With so many options available on the market, it can be difficult to determine which server best suits your needs. Assess factors such as processing power, memory capacity, storage options, and network connectivity when making your decision. A well-chosen rack server will provide the structure for a reliable and efficient data center environment.
